a3t3mbk’s blog

元”theネットワークエンジニアを目指していたがネットワークエンジニアとして一回も働けなかった人間”が全くキャリアを積めず自分がぐちゃぐちゃなった結果、鬱でドクターストップののち、プログラマーとして再起を目指すブログです。(やはりPCは好きなんだな

twitterでダウロードした画像用のRubyスクリプト書いた

普段Chrome使ってるんですが、ツイッターで画像とか保存すると拡張子が001.jpg_largeとかになります。

手動で拡張子をjpgにすれば普通の画像なんですが、せっかくRubyを勉強したので、簡単なスクリプトをググりながら書きました。

参考にさせていただきましたのはこちら!ありがとうございます! (リンク先は、txtファイルをhtmlに一括変換するスクリプトの例です)

ja.stackoverflow.com

require 'fileutils'

old_ext = ".jpg_large"
new_ext = ".jpg"

Dir::glob("./*#{old_ext}").each do |filename|
        newfilename = filename.gsub(/#{old_ext}$/, new_ext)
        File.rename(filename, newfilename)
end

ファイル名をlarge-delete.rbにしてダウンロードしたファイルと同じディレクトリに入れてダブルクリックするだけ!

1つ2つだと手動でリネームした方が早い気がする

いやー、こんな単純なスクリプト書くのにも結構時間かかるもんですね。初心者だと。 でも仕方ない。

少しずつやっていく!